Lucky you--heading out on a fabulous cruise. Can I go with?

 

We really enjoyed the location of our hotel as it was just slightly down the street from a HOHO bus stop, as well as the subway. It was a bit of a hike to Las Ramblas, but it made for a good after-dinner walk. And, it was quiet on our street! We also loved the neat rooftop terrace.

 

Fav things for the kids--

1--Running thru those darn pigeons.

2--Park Guell. We spent a whole afternoon there.

3--Riding on the upper deck of the HOHO buses.

4--The maritime museum

5--The living statues in Las Ramblas

 

There was also a kids park that we never made it to, with topiary maze and playgrounds. Don't remember the name, but it would be listed in the Barcelona guidebooks.

 

I recommend you have a good plan when visit, so you don't hem/haw trying to figure out what to do.
